Summer convention season has always created a difficult contradiction for cosplayers.

You want the costume to look impressive.

But you also have to survive wearing it.

That problem became particularly visible at San Diego Comic-Con 2026, where Reuters reported on cosplayers dealing with summer heat, elaborate costumes, and unexpected costume failures. The report noted that heat could soften glue and cause costume pieces to fall apart, while fabric could rip or tear after months of preparation.

The problem goes beyond comfort.

Heat can affect:

  • Adhesives
  • Foam
  • Fabric
  • Wig styling
  • Makeup
  • Electronics
  • Armor
  • Straps
  • Fasteners
  • Body temperature
  • Overall costume durability

At the same convention, a volunteer dressed as Fix-it Felix carried a roughly 15-pound repair backpack containing items ranging from superglue and duct tape to safety pins, soldering equipment, and a hot glue gun to help repair damaged costumes.

That makes one thing clear:

Summer cosplay is becoming a costume-engineering problem.

So how should cosplayers approach heat-proof cosplay in 2026?


1. Why Is Summer Convention Cosplay So Difficult in Hot Weather?

Direct Answer

Summer cosplay is difficult because elaborate costumes can trap heat, restrict airflow, add weight, and place additional stress on adhesives, fabrics, wigs, and electronics. The safest approach is to design ventilation and lightweight construction into the costume from the beginning.

A costume that works perfectly inside a cool room may behave very differently after several hours at a crowded summer convention.

The challenge comes from multiple factors working together.

Heat from the environment

Outdoor convention lines can expose cosplayers to direct sunlight and high temperatures.

Even when the main convention floor is air-conditioned, you may still spend time:

  • Walking outside
  • Waiting in lines
  • Crossing between buildings
  • Taking outdoor photos
  • Waiting for transportation
  • Standing in crowded areas

This makes hot weather cosplay fundamentally different from indoor cosplay.

Heat generated by your own body

Your body continuously produces heat.

A costume can make it harder for that heat to escape.

This is especially noticeable with:

  • Full-body suits
  • Heavy armor
  • Wigs
  • Masks
  • Cloaks
  • Thick synthetic fabrics
  • Foam bodysuits
  • Multiple layers

The costume does not have to be extremely heavy to become uncomfortable.

Even a relatively lightweight costume can feel exhausting if airflow is poor.

Heat plus movement

Cosplay is rarely static.

At a convention you may walk several miles without realizing it.

You may also:

  • Pose for photos
  • Climb stairs
  • Stand in lines
  • Dance
  • Attend panels
  • Carry props
  • Move between buildings

A costume that feels comfortable for 20 minutes may become uncomfortable after four hours.

That is why comfortable cosplay costumes should be evaluated based on the entire convention day, not simply the first fitting.


2. Which Fabrics Are Best for Hot-Weather Cosplay?Q2 and Q3 - Breathable Fabrics and Lightweight Armor

Direct Answer

The best breathable cosplay fabrics are generally lightweight materials that allow moisture and heat to escape. Depending on the character, options such as lightweight cotton, linen blends, mesh, performance fabrics, and breathable lining can reduce heat buildup compared with thick, non-breathable synthetics.

Fabric choice is one of the easiest places to improve a summer costume.

But the “best” fabric depends on what you are trying to recreate.


Lightweight Cotton

Cotton can be useful for casual or everyday-style cosplay.

Advantages include:

  • Familiar feel
  • Relatively breathable
  • Easy to sew
  • Widely available
  • Comfortable against the skin

However, cotton can absorb sweat and remain wet for longer.

For extremely hot conditions, a moisture-managing performance fabric may sometimes be more practical.


Linen and Linen Blends

Linen is naturally associated with warm-weather clothing because of its lightweight structure and airflow.

It can work particularly well for:

  • Historical-inspired cosplay
  • Fantasy costumes
  • Casual character designs
  • Loose shirts
  • Dresses
  • Capes
  • Trousers

Its slightly textured appearance can also work beautifully for costumes that do not require perfectly smooth surfaces.


Mesh

Mesh can be extremely useful when incorporated strategically.

You do not necessarily need visible mesh everywhere.

Instead, hide breathable mesh in areas such as:

  • Underarms
  • Side panels
  • Back panels
  • Inside armor
  • Helmet vents
  • Costume lining

This creates airflow without dramatically changing the exterior appearance.


Performance Fabrics

Modern athletic fabrics can be useful for costumes requiring extensive movement.

They can help manage:

  • Sweat
  • Moisture
  • Stretch
  • Body movement

This is especially useful for:

  • Bodysuits
  • Superhero cosplay
  • Dance-heavy costumes
  • Character performance
  • Full-day convention wear

The important principle is simple:

Do not automatically choose the fabric that looks most accurate if it makes the costume impossible to wear.

A slightly different fabric that keeps you comfortable may produce a better overall result because you can actually wear the costume for the entire event.


3. How Can Cosplayers Make Armor Lighter and More Breathable?

Direct Answer

Use lightweight materials such as EVA foam, thin thermoplastics, lightweight plastics, and hollow or simplified structures instead of unnecessarily dense construction. Add ventilation openings and avoid covering areas that do not need rigid protection.

Armor is one of the biggest challenges in summer cosplay.

A visually impressive armor set can become a portable heat trap.

That does not mean you need to eliminate armor.

It means you should rethink where the weight and material are actually necessary.


Use Lightweight Armor Materials

Lightweight cosplay armor can often be constructed from materials such as EVA foam.

Foam allows you to create:

  • Shoulder armor
  • Chest pieces
  • Bracers
  • Belts
  • Helmets
  • Decorative panels
  • Large silhouettes

without making the costume unnecessarily heavy.

For larger armor pieces, consider whether the internal structure actually needs to be solid.

A hollow structure can sometimes provide the visual volume you need without adding unnecessary weight.


Remove Hidden Material

Ask yourself:

“Does this material contribute to the appearance?”

If the answer is no, consider removing it.

This is particularly useful inside:

  • Shoulder pieces
  • Helmets
  • Large props
  • Chest armor
  • Back armor

You can often reduce weight dramatically by simplifying the interior while preserving the exterior silhouette.


Add Ventilation

Ventilation should be planned during construction.

Possible locations include:

  • Under the arms
  • Along the sides
  • Behind armor panels
  • Inside helmets
  • Along the back
  • Beneath capes
  • Around waist areas

The best ventilation is often invisible.

From the outside, the costume remains visually accurate.

Inside, air can circulate.


4. Can Heat Affect Cosplay Adhesives?Q4 - Heat and Adhesive Failures

Direct Answer

Yes. Heat can affect some adhesives, especially when a costume relies heavily on hot glue or adhesive-backed fasteners. Reuters specifically reported that high temperatures at SDCC 2026 could soften glue and cause costume pieces to separate.

This is one of the most important lessons from the 2026 convention season.

A costume can be structurally sound in your home and fail at the convention.

Why?

Because temperature changes the conditions under which your adhesive is operating.


Why Hot Glue Can Become a Problem

Hot glue is popular because it is:

  • Cheap
  • Fast
  • Easy to apply
  • Beginner-friendly

But it should not automatically be treated as the strongest solution for every costume component.

If a structural part experiences:

  • Heat
  • Movement
  • Pulling
  • Sweat
  • Repeated impact

the bond may eventually fail.

That does not mean hot glue has no place in cosplay.

It simply means you should understand what the adhesive is being asked to do.


Use Mechanical Reinforcement

For important structural areas, consider combining adhesive with:

  • Sewing
  • Rivets
  • Elastic
  • Velcro
  • Snaps
  • Straps
  • Reinforcing fabric
  • Mechanical fasteners

Think of adhesive as one part of the construction system, rather than the entire system.

This becomes particularly important for:

  • Armor straps
  • Shoulder pieces
  • Large props
  • Heavy accessories
  • Costume closures

Test Before the Convention

One of the best ways to prevent a costume failure is simple:

Test it under realistic conditions.

Wear the costume for several hours.

Walk around.

Sit down.

Climb stairs.

Move your arms.

Take photos.

Then inspect the costume.

If something starts loosening during your test, it is much better to discover the problem at home than at a convention.


5. Do Cooling Systems for Cosplay Actually Help?Q5 - Cosplay Cooling Systems

Direct Answer

Cooling systems can help reduce discomfort in demanding costumes, particularly full-body suits, helmets, armor, and costumes with limited airflow. Their effectiveness depends on the design, power source, ventilation, and duration of use.

This is where cosplay begins to resemble wearable technology.

Simple cooling solutions can include:

  • Portable fans
  • USB fans
  • Ventilation fans inside helmets
  • Cooling towels
  • Ice packs
  • Hydration packs
  • Battery-powered ventilation

More advanced builds can incorporate active cooling into helmets or armor.


Helmet Ventilation

Helmets are especially challenging.

They can trap:

  • Heat
  • Moisture
  • Breath
  • Sweat

A small fan positioned to move air through the helmet can make a significant difference.

The key is airflow.

A fan that simply moves hot air around inside a sealed helmet is less useful than a system designed with:

air intake → airflow → exhaust

in mind.


Battery Management

If you use powered cooling systems, remember that batteries introduce another design requirement.

Before the convention, test:

  • Battery life
  • Fan speed
  • Cable placement
  • Switch accessibility
  • Heat generated by electronics
  • Recharge requirements

Do not discover that your cooling system lasts only two hours after arriving at an all-day convention.


6. How Can You Prevent Costume Malfunctions at a Summer Convention?Q6 - Malfunction Prevention and Repair Kit

Direct Answer

The best way to prevent summer costume malfunctions is to combine realistic pre-convention testing, stronger structural reinforcement, lightweight materials, breathable construction, and an emergency repair kit. You should assume that something may eventually need adjustment.

SDCC 2026 demonstrated why this matters.

Reuters reported both heat-related material failures and the presence of a dedicated volunteer carrying a large cosplay repair kit.

The San Diego Public Library also operated a Cosplay Repair Station during Comic-Con 2026, offering tools and supplies including sewing equipment, 3D printers, laser cutters, soldering irons, safety pins, adhesives, tape, and wig supplies.

That tells us something important:

Emergency cosplay repair is becoming part of the convention ecosystem.

But you should still prepare your own kit.


Build a Summer Convention Repair Kit

A compact emergency kit could include:

  • Safety pins
  • Double-sided tape
  • Fabric tape
  • Strong adhesive
  • Small scissors
  • Needle and thread
  • Extra elastic
  • Hair ties
  • Bobby pins
  • Velcro
  • Spare buttons
  • Spare straps
  • Small zip ties
  • Mini sewing kit

For electronic costumes, consider carrying:

  • Spare batteries
  • Charging cable
  • Power bank
  • Electrical tape

The exact contents depend on your costume.


Bring Spare Parts

This is one of the easiest improvements.

If your costume uses a specific:

  • Button
  • Strap
  • Buckle
  • Wig accessory
  • Elastic component
  • Decorative piece

bring a spare.

A five-dollar replacement part can save a costume that took months to create.


7. Is Heat-Proof Cosplay Really About Materials?

Not entirely.

This may be the most important lesson.

Heat-proof cosplay is fundamentally about design decisions.

You can buy the most advanced cooling equipment in the world and still have an uncomfortable costume if the underlying design traps heat.

Think about the costume as a system.

Layer 1: Skin

What touches your body?

Choose comfortable, breathable materials.

Layer 2: Clothing

Can air circulate?

Can sweat escape?

Layer 3: Armor

Does the armor need to cover the entire area?

Can it be lighter?

Can it be ventilated?

Layer 4: Accessories

Are they adding unnecessary weight?

Layer 5: Electronics

Can batteries and wiring be safely positioned?

Layer 6: Environment

Will you be outside?

Will you stand in line?

Will you walk several miles?

The best summer convention cosplay takes all six layers into account.

A Practical Heat-Proof Cosplay Checklist

Before taking your costume to a summer convention, ask:

Materials

  • Is the main fabric breathable?
  • Is the armor unnecessarily heavy?
  • Are the adhesives appropriate for the application?
  • Are important structural areas reinforced?

Ventilation

  • Can air move through the costume?
  • Is the helmet ventilated?
  • Are there hidden mesh panels?
  • Can trapped heat escape?

Comfort

  • Can you sit down?
  • Can you walk comfortably?
  • Can you use the bathroom?
  • Can you drink water easily?
  • Can you wear the costume for several hours?

Durability

  • Have you tested the costume?
  • Have you stressed the straps?
  • Have you tested adhesives?
  • Have you checked seams?

Emergency Preparation

  • Do you have a repair kit?
  • Do you have spare batteries?
  • Do you have replacement straps?
  • Do you have a backup plan?

The goal is not to make your costume indestructible.

The goal is to make failure manageable.
